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7853054888 83788 0424612
517124 65352741
517124 65352741
53359 16417769 71
All about undefined
Interested in learning more?
517124 65352741
53359 16417769 71
See more
59127 5455 34685
4902 70 49324057
See more
6738 6930909 011
10933957 677632 4455103
See more